PHP和JAVA,无法单纯的去评价谁更适合用作高端OA的开发语言
金无足赤,和很多开发语言一样,JAVA也有其自身的缺憾,它开发费用高、开发周期长,且其运行受到生产环境的极大限制。因为JAVA是需要跑在虚拟机上的,虚拟机的性能和稳定性,直接制约了JAVA的运行。包含虚拟机、JAVA运行环境、服务程序的产品我们通常称之为JAVA应用服务器。JAVA对应用服务器等硬件要求也非常高。举个例子:为了保证采用JAVA语言的OA软件运行稳定,JAVA应用服务器集群全部采用Weblogic,数据库集群全部采用Oracle,仅此两项采购费用就高达200万。试问:目前市面卖10~30万的OA,又有哪些厂商肯承诺是包含了正版Weblogic应用服务器和Oracle数据库的?恐怕项目费用连采购这些软件的成本都不够,往往仅是包含了Tomcat、Jboss、Resin等免费的JAVA应用服务器,如此一来,JAVA的诸多优势难免要大打折扣。
PHP是一种解释性语言,相较于JAVA而言,它易学易用、容易上手,其跨平台、支持面向对象的开发、支持丰富的数据库类型、提供庞大的扩展函数库、甚至支持JAVA混合开发等技术特性都是业界领先的。从市场应用来说,国内知名的门户网站——新浪、搜狐等一流的IT商都在使用,腾讯去年也收购了占据国内论坛软件市场份额80%的Discuz!论坛软件。全球知名的社交网站Facebook采用Linux+PHP+memcached,支撑全世界最大的社区,使用用户达数亿。
PHP相对JAVA来说,还有一个绝对优势:PHP来自于开源社区,是免费的。而JAVA随着其发明者SUN公司被Oracle收购,版权问题已引起业内广泛关注。近期Oracle起诉Google,追究其在Andriod系统中使用了JAVA技术而没有交专利费。
所以,PHP和JAVA,无法单纯的去评价谁更适合用作高端OA的开发语言。换句话说,即无法单纯的根据开发语言去判断一款OA软件是高端还是低端。对于企业而言,采用OA软件是实现全员信息化协同办公的一种手段,稳定性、易用性、人性化是关键,高性能是根基。就易用性、软件基础功能而言,也没有高端、低端之说。在合适的地方,用合适的语言,充分发挥其特点,这才是选取开发语言的标准。
- 1erp组成的几大基础模块
- 2泛普OA软件的设计目标与功能结构介绍
- 3在OA办公系统中,我们同样有"管家"—--人事行政事务板块
- 4OA办公自动化正在逐步颠覆着传统办公模式,包括地域局限
- 5OA所具备的特质不是大而全,而应是专一
- 6OA在中国现在还是初级阶段,要考虑怎么落地的问题
- 7看ERP软件是否适用的五大判断招数
- 8OA实施过程中参与人员的时间成本、培训成本
- 9泛普OA也包含部分CRM和ERP的功能,而且做得不错
- 10微软正在操作一个与其他主要的OA软件厂商截然不同的OA世界
- 11OA办公系统发展到现在,其内涵已经发生了根本的转变
- 12办公软件系统学习
- 132012年世界末日之后,我们发现彼此都还活着
- 14目前在国内OA应用越来越广泛
- 15ERP实施中的降险方法三:人的因素是第一位
- 16进以泛普OA统一用户与身份认证系统为代表的信息化统一平台
- 17“舍得舍得,有舍才有得”这句话其实是有一定道理的
- 18泛普软件告诉您OA公系统中的安全问题
- 19胸怀大局就需要借助OA办公系统的精细化管理来实现
- 20OA办公系统软件都能够帮助您实现全面的办公管理和高效的业务运作
- 21OA软件同用户原有ERP、CRM、HR、SCM等业务系统的集成
- 22几十万的终端用户正在体验着泛普OA的价值和工作的快乐
- 23产业进入发展的快车道,未来协同OA软件技术路线的分水岭逐步形成
- 24这几年泛普软件转型做渠道以来,我们积累了一批合作伙伴
- 25OA办公系统管理软件本身必须改变,而日趋成熟的互联网技术让这个变革成为可能
- 26如何合理设置泛普软件oa系统的功能
- 27企业信息安全应从文档管理软件入手
- 28一套OA办公系统卖给了运营商,人家用我们的软件做服务
- 29泛普OA办公体系极大地节省单位的办理本钱和运营本钱
- 30纪检监察机关主要领导要带头使用市纪委、监察局集成OA办公系统
成都公司:成都市成华区建设南路160号1层9号
重庆公司:重庆市江北区红旗河沟华创商务大厦18楼